Metropolitan Ephrem of Tripoli prayerfully remember Romanian theologians Dumitru Staniloae and Andrei Scrima at Cernica Monastery

On Thursday, Antiochian Metropolitan Ephrem of Tripoli, Al-Koura, and Dependencies commemorated Fathers Dumitru Stăniloae and Andrei Scrima at Cernica Monastery.

The memorial service was attended by His Grace Bishop Qais Sadiq, Patriarchal Auxiliary Bishop of the Patriarchate of Antioch and All the East, who cares for the Arab community in Bucharest, Rev. Professor Porphyrios Georgi from the Theological Institute of the University of Balamand, and Protosyncellys Vasile Pârjol, Abbot of Cernica Monastery.

“We have come to this holy place to offer our prayers for the repose of the souls of Father Professor Dumitru Stăniloae and Father Andrei Scrima,” declared the Metropolitan.

His Eminence Metropolitan Ephrem recalled meeting Father Andrei Scrima at St. George Monastery in Deir el Harf, the mountains of Lebanon. “Fr. Andrei Scrima was the spiritual father of the monastic community.”

“I remember very well when he was there. I was a student and I recall vividly attending meetings where he explained the Gospel of John. Glory to God for giving us this opportunity to lift our prayers for the repose of the souls of Fr. Dumitru Stăniloae and Fr. Andrei Scrima.”

Metropolitan Ephrem mentioned that although he did not personally know Father Dumitru Stăniloae, he has profound respect for him.

Father Porphyrios Georgi testified, “We came to know Father Stăniloae through our Antiochian students who studied in Bucharest, and we had the chance to read his works translated into various languages. Without a doubt, all who knew Fr. Professor Dumitru Stăniloae agree that his presence was a living testimony of Orthodox faith and his life was a vivid witness of faith.”

“As a professor at the Theological Institute of the University of Balamand, we are delighted that a married priest and dogmatist will be declared and canonized as a saint. This is a great joy for us,” said Fr. Porphyrios.

After the memorial service, Metropolitan Ephrem visited the churches of Cernica Monastery and the museum of the monastic settlement.

Metropolitan Ephrem of Tripoli, Al-Koura, and Dependencies also participated in the patronal feast of Sângeap Basaraba Monastery in Iași County last week.
